Abstract:
Diabetic Mellitus (DM) is a major public health problem all over the world. The disease results in tremendous medical as well as economic burden globally. Various methods of treatment of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us are evolving rapidly because the existing interventions have not completely cured the disease. Individualised homoeopathic medicine is effective in the management of Type 2 DM. Various studies shows that Yoga therapy is effective in reducing the blood glucose levels in patients with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us. This paper aims to provide a comprehensive understanding of various pranayama’s and Yogasanas as an adjunct to Individualised homoeopathic medicines in the management of Type 2 DM.
